Default MagickNet dll strong name

I would like to use the compiled DLL available for MagickNet, located here:

http://midimick.com/magicknet/files/...ll.1.0.0.3.zip

But the version posted is not signed.
  1. Is there a signed version (strong name = true) of the MagickNet DLL for download somewhere ?
  2. When I compiled MagickNet myself, the resulting DLL was small (about 100KB) compared to the posted DLL on MidiMick.com (over 2MB). It seems the DLL posted has the IM libraries inside it. Is that true? Dependency walker shows no dependencies in the posted version. How are libraries imported into a DLL in VS2005?
